The artistic ambition behind the best PlayStation games is unmistakable. Games like Shadow of the Colossus use minimalist storytelling and vast, haunting landscapes to evoke profound emotions. Similarly, Journey on PS3 and later platforms offers a meditative, wordless experience that connects players emotionally through gameplay and visuals alone. These titles show that games can be moving works of art that communicate beyond dialogue or action.
On the technical side, PlayStation consoles have pushed hardware boundaries to support increasingly immersive worlds. The leap from PS2’s relatively modest 3D environments to PS5’s photorealistic visuals with ray tracing showcases how technology enhances artistic expression. Faster loading times and more detailed textures make these virtual worlds more believable and inviting, allowing players to explore rich environments that feel alive.
